That sounds like you were letting the clutch out too quickly. The biggest part of learning to drive a manual is feeling out the progression of the clutch. As you let it out SLOWLY (letting it out too quickly without keeping the RPMs up with the throttle causes it to stall; the clutch is not an on/off switch), you’ll…
It does take practice to get good at it, but it also takes literally 30 minutes of learning to be able to at least drive a manual. Give it another try some time! You’ll like it. :)
